Medical Coder Job Functions

Medical coders are on the front line of the billing systems for Utica IL medical practices and healthcare organizations. They have the responsibility to analyze the treatment records of patients and convert all services provided into universal codes. These services can be for medical, diagnosis or dental procedures, or any equipment or medical supplies utilized. There are several codes that are used in the conversion, including:

  • CPT codes (Current Procedural Terminology).
  • ICD codes (International Classification of Diseases).
  • HCPCS codes (Healthcare Common Procedure Coding).

Medical coders use information from sources such as physician and nursing notes, patient charts, and lab and radiology reports. Medical Coders must not only know what services were provided in total for accurate reporting, but must have a working knowledge of all government and private payer regulations that influence coding as well. Incorrectly coded claims may lead to services not being paid for, services being paid at a reduced rate, or the provider being penalized for fraudulent or improper billing. Since improper coding can in fact cost Utica IL physicians and medical facilities many thousands of dollars in earnings annually, a proficient medical coder is a vital asset for any healthcare team. They can work in any type of healthcare facility, including private practices, hospitals, clinics and urgent care centers. It is not unusual for seasoned medical coders to work at home as an offsite employee or an independent contractor.

Medical Biller Job Description

Utica IL medical billers collect revenueAs vital as the medical coder’s job is, it would be for naught without the contribution of the medical biller whose efforts generate revenue. Medical billing clerks are extremely important to Utica IL medical organizations and are essentially responsible for keeping their doors open. Frequently the biller and coder are the same individual within a healthcare organization, but they can also be two independent specialists. When the coder has carried out his or her job, the biller uses the codes supplied to complete and submit claim forms to insurance carriers, Medicaid or Medicare. After being paid by the applicable entity, patients can then be invoiced for deductibles and additional out of pocket expenses. On a regular basis, a medical biller might also do any of the following:

  • Verify health insurance coverages for patients and help them with billing questions or concerns
  • Check on patient claims submitted and appeal those that have been declined
  • Work as an intermediary between the medical provider, the insurance carriers and the patients for correct claim resolution
  • Produce and manage Accounts Receivables reports
  • Generate and handle unpaid patient collections accounts

Medical billing clerks not only work for private practices, but also Utica IL hospitals, urgent care facilities, nursing homes or medical groups. They may practice in every type of medical facility that depends on the incomes generated from billing third party payers and patients.

Medical Biller and Coder Online Instruction and Certification

Utica IL patients are billed for medical treatmentIt’s important that you receive your training from a reputable school, whether it’s a trade school, vocational school or community college. Even though it is not required in most cases to earn a professional certification, the school you enroll in should be accredited (more on the benefits of accreditation later). Most colleges just require that you have either a high school diploma or a GED to appy. The quickest way to become either a medical coder or biller (or both) is to obtain a certificate, which normally takes about one year to accomplish. An Associate Degree is an alternative for a more expansive education, which for almost all programs calls for 2 years of studies. Bachelor’s Degrees in medical billing and coding are not widely offered. After your training has been concluded, although not mandated in most states, you may desire to earn a professional certification. Certification is an effective method for those new to the field to show prospective employers that they are not only qualified but dedicated to their career. A few of the organizations that make available certifications are:

  • American Academy of Professional Coders (AAPC).
  • Board of Medical Specialty Coding (BMSC).
  • The Professional Association of Healthcare Coding Specialists (PAHCS).
  • American Health Information Management Association (AHIMA).

Completing an accredited medical coding and billing course, combined with obtaining a professional certification, are the best ways to accelerate your new profession and succeed in the rapid growing healthcare field.

North Utica, Illinois

North Utica, often known as Utica, is a village in Utica Township, LaSalle County, Illinois. The population was 1352 at the 2010 United States Census. It is part of the Ottawa–Streator Micropolitan Statistical Area.

While North Utica is the proper name for the city, advertising on nearby Interstates 80 and 39 refers to the village by its original name, Utica. In addition, people who live in the area, official Interstate signage, and signs indicating the city limits all refer to the town as Utica.[citation needed]

The town of Utica had previously been established on the banks of the Illinois River during the 1830s, but flooding and the construction of the Illinois and Michigan Canal a few miles north encouraged redevelopment of the village there as North Utica.
